There’s a simple framework used in many industries:
Fast. Cheap. Good. Pick two.
But what Sharon McClafferty is increasingly seeing is something far worse: people entering situations that deliver none of the three.
No clear result.
No defined timeline.
No real understanding of cost.
In this episode of High Agency, Sharon explores why this happens and how high-agency thinkers approach decisions differently.
After more than two decades working with accounting and financial planning firms, Sharon has developed strong pattern recognition for situations where effort will be high and outcomes disappointing — not because people lack capability, but because no one paused to decide what actually mattered most.
Through a series of stories — including a family law consultation, a clever real estate negotiation, and a Brisbane architect who forces clients to prioritise trade-offs — Sharon illustrates how clarity around time, cost and result can transform the decisions we make.
Because every important decision sits somewhere inside that triangle.
The problem isn’t that trade-offs exist.
The problem is when no one names them.

Key Insight
Every meaningful decision involves three variables:
Time
Cost
Result
One will always matter most — whether you acknowledge it or not.
High agency simply means pausing to decide which one it is, and behaving accordingly.
